Where is the Columbia River Basin?

Location: Western North America (United States and Canada)

The Columbia River Basin is primarily located in the northwestern United States, with a relatively small portion extending into southeastern British Columbia in Canada. It encompasses parts of seven US states – Idaho, Montana, Oregon, Nevada, Utah, Washington, and Wyoming. The Columbia River itself begins in the Canadian Rockies of British Columbia and, after traversing through various landscapes such as lush forests, scenic deserts, and fertile valleys, eventually discharges its waters into the Pacific Ocean near Astoria, Oregon. Overall, the Columbia River Basin is known for its abundant natural resources, breathtaking ecosystems, and diverse economic activities.
